How to Prevent Debt from Hurting Economic Growth

Inter-American Development Bank

This effect can be particularly important in countries with scarce physical and human capital. This means that there is a tipping point, or threshold, at which higher debt levels become detrimental to growth. For LAC countries, this threshold is at approximately 53 percent of GDP. 5 New Public Works Bills Passed by Washington Legislature

Mike Purdy's Public Contracting

In order to bring Washington law in compliance with federal small works bonding requirements, Senate Bill 5734 , which passed both the House and Senate unanimously, addresses the following: Changes Project Amount: Increases the $35,000 threshold to $150,000.
